"这篇文档是阜阳师范学院计算机与信息学院的数据库原理实验指导,主要讲解了SQL Server 2000的相关知识,包括数据库构架、数据库管理、表、索引、视图、触发器、存储过程等内容,并提供了多个相关的实践实验。"
在《数据库构架-oracle 12c创建可插拔数据库(pdb)与用户详解》这个主题中,我们关注的是Oracle 12c的可插拔数据库(PDB)和用户管理。然而,提供的资源摘要信息主要涵盖了SQL Server 2000的基础知识,包括:
1. **数据库构架**:SQL Server 2000的数据存储在数据库中,逻辑组件如表、视图、过程和用户是用户主要打交道的部分,而物理实现通常对用户透明,由数据库管理员负责管理。每个实例有四个系统数据库(master、model、tempdb 和 msdb)和一个或多个用户数据库。
2. **数据库组件**:介绍了数据库的组成部分,包括系统和示例数据库,以及在设计数据库时需要考虑的因素。
3. **表**:讲解了如何设计、创建、修改和删除表,这是数据库中的基本数据结构。
4. **索引**:讨论了索引的设计、创建和删除,索引用于提高查询性能。
5. **视图**:视图作为虚拟表提供了一种数据抽象,介绍了创建、修改、重命名和删除视图的操作。
6. **触发器**:触发器是自动执行的数据库操作,用于在特定事件(如INSERT、UPDATE或DELETE)发生时执行某些代码。
7. **存储过程**:存储过程是预编译的SQL语句集合,可用于执行复杂的数据库操作,包括创建、执行和删除存储过程。
8. **实验部分**:提供了多个实验,帮助学习者通过实践掌握SQL Server 2000的基本操作,涵盖从认识SQL Server到数据定义、数据操纵、视图、安全性、完整性、触发器、存储过程、数据库备份和还原、数据导入导出,以及数据库应用系统设计。
虽然这些内容并未直接涉及Oracle 12c的PDB创建,但它们构成了理解任何关系数据库管理系统的基础,包括Oracle。在Oracle 12c中,PDB是一种可以独立创建、备份、恢复和升级的数据库,允许在一个容器数据库(CDB)中管理多个PDB,提供了更高的灵活性和资源隔离。用户管理在Oracle中同样重要,涉及到用户账户的创建、权限分配和安全管理。